> +=======================
> +Kexec Handover Concepts
> +=======================
> +
> +Kexec HandOver (KHO) is a mechanism that allows Linux to preserve state -
> +arbitrary properties as well as memory locations - across kexec.
> +
> +It introduces multiple concepts:
> +
> +KHO Device Tree
> +---------------
> +
> +Every KHO kexec carries a KHO specific flattened device tree blob that
> +describes the state of the system. Device drivers can register to KHO to
> +serialize their state before kexec. After KHO, device drivers can read
> +the device tree and extract previous state.
> +
> +KHO only uses the fdt container format and libfdt library, but does not
> +adhere to the same property semantics that normal device trees do: Properties
> +are passed in native endianness and standardized properties like ``regs`` and
> +``ranges`` do not exist, hence there are no ``#...-cells`` properties.
> +
> +KHO introduces a new concept to its device tree: ``mem`` properties. A
> +``mem`` property can inside any subnode in the device tree. When present,
